When enabled, only the specified amount of replays will be saved and the oldest one gets deleted if the maximum allowed number is exceeded. When enabled, the game creates a folder for the current version of the game within the replays folder (e.g. Separate replays folder for each game version We recommend to keep it turned on though, as it can help with troubleshooting issues and reporting bugs as well as sharing those awesome battles with the community! )ΔΆ. If you want, you can untick the box and disable the recording of replays with this option. ![]() Please note: As the configuration file ( engine_config.xml) might be changed with an update, the replay settings are saved as a mod and you need to run and apply these settings after each update.
